    Cool tips but carny games are almost always a rip off.
    Normal looking games that are tweaked to the point of impossible. (Basket ball hoops being smaller than normal, ring toss with the ring just barely fitting, etc.)
    Not many people realize you have to play the normal looking game in an unorthodox way and have to rely on physics and timing to land a win.
    Chances of winning are slim like the lottery.

    You really have to watch a carny's move after he demonstrates how to play. See if they take something away, add something, give you a different set of balls etc.

    I will say that some Carnival carny games aren't always rigged. Just the majority of them.

    This thread is just for fun and awareness. I always watch others play, we go to the Carnival to have fun and take our chances on the game.
